summ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Samuli Suominen <ssuominen@gentoo.org>2009-10-14 09:56:39 +0000
committerSamuli Suominen <ssuominen@gentoo.org>2009-10-14 09:56:39 +0000
commit692b41315f6f20bb8c488c6be039febe1e10e77b (patch)
treec5551c10ec065d84a8fabf8fc18b9c38f28a38e8 /dev-python
parentRemove USE gcc-libffi because it's conflicting with dev-libs/libffi in ld.so.... (diff)
downloadhistorical-692b41315f6f20bb8c488c6be039febe1e10e77b.tar.gz
historical-692b41315f6f20bb8c488c6be039febe1e10e77b.tar.bz2
historical-692b41315f6f20bb8c488c6be039febe1e10e77b.zip
Remove support for gcc's libffi because it's conflicting with dev-libs/libffi in ld.so.conf.
Package-Manager: portage-2.2_rc46/cvs/Linux x86_64
Diffstat (limited to 'dev-python')
-rw-r--r--dev-python/pygobject/ChangeLog7
-rw-r--r--dev-python/pygobject/Manifest6
-rw-r--r--dev-python/pygobject/pygobject-2.14.2.ebuild10
-rw-r--r--dev-python/pygobject/pygobject-2.15.4.ebuild10
4 files changed, 15 insertions, 18 deletions
diff --git a/dev-python/pygobject/ChangeLog b/dev-python/pygobject/ChangeLog
index 233df990c582..7ddb228b7276 100644
--- a/dev-python/pygobject/ChangeLog
+++ b/dev-python/pygobject/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for dev-python/pygobject
#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/pygobject/ChangeLog,v 1.82 2009/10/11 15:56:08 arfrever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pygobject/ChangeLog,v 1.83 2009/10/14 09:56:39 ssuominen Exp $
+
+ 14 Oct 2009; Samuli Suominen <ssuominen@gentoo.org>
+ pygobject-2.14.2.ebuild, pygobject-2.15.4.ebuild:
+ Remove support for gcc's libffi because it's conflicting with
+ dev-libs/libffi in ld.so.conf.
11 Oct 2009;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org>
pygobject-2.18.0-r2.ebuild:
diff --git a/dev-python/pygobject/Manifest b/dev-python/pygobject/Manifest
index 493cd813cba0..f6c7e0e5a20c 100644
--- a/dev-python/pygobject/Manifest
+++ b/dev-python/pygobject/Manifest
@@ -10,12 +10,12 @@ DIST pygobject-2.16.0.tar.bz2 515503 RMD160 509cddab25ab084706bc69d3c6c90f490251
DIST pygobject-2.16.1.tar.bz2 522347 RMD160 37f4075af9c06aba4fca47e2580c5408dbc28845 SHA1 12ce140438e7ff7e1a26fe4bba9a26b49f80ec0d SHA256 ee229c642759470a242c7f6ce3bd969a7484496f95570a8783859b03d6d79cc5
DIST pygobject-2.18.0.tar.bz2 639205 RMD160 db454107949b0e797c6c151aa426368ef0f59317 SHA1 f800eda7978fe9813600cfdda973da15c3178bb0 SHA256 b11b840ae31e6e644986806ee3400f4528b803d07b6cee26add45e0f2e5e622b
EBUILD pygobject-2.14.0.ebuild 2433 RMD160 74d4f3ac7c36b394ce35f7f7296378b601acc076 SHA1 96bea289811b38c8e4be289f0dad100406037fcb SHA256 b85959bceec48b5e53f5a54bbdb096067cc86b7c4cddd02acd580cc72e95c382
-EBUILD pygobject-2.14.2.ebuild 2730 RMD160 3f120f703b72796e7df2357736c57ecfb1d241f0 SHA1 281072730a66e5fbae6139f3f0f58df6cdcecd35 SHA256 de145e00a6c38282d4e33e3b781b9c7e1c83d13418b091a374d25c4cec67f7f9
-EBUILD pygobject-2.15.4.ebuild 2186 RMD160 49d3a224ca0a05e605c05f0da58c5f5da5105c16 SHA1 2a746379f3654489be2543d630ff7105292bf857 SHA256 bc1524f543681f56ac244abec54e642eb3dd66b9c72dcb51e9572aec0862b68d
+EBUILD pygobject-2.14.2.ebuild 2594 RMD160 bef6710cdb877ff97272871aaace84d81f9b93ba SHA1 d86de671dd33a78a17b2ddc3942e3d3b0d4e3c90 SHA256 4ca96184de921be9875a9098063109bd00bb1a0f22986babfdd723625fa132b0
+EBUILD pygobject-2.15.4.ebuild 2050 RMD160 7fb956f10d2e924c3813a260eec63d3853806bb8 SHA1 e9dd957746d723824b9b9498e7475061985359b1 SHA256 4fbf686349def20bc8898b225117de4edbfd9101a3e80bdf7a38c9ba8012b5f1
EBUILD pygobject-2.16.0.ebuild 2295 RMD160 03069f9f486c6e21d32a9ce5c0d7098197df814c SHA1 8c0f2c1fb4f4c8de181e08740fbb6bf4a86509b6 SHA256 989117c44b877704dc96b3e61b9869c8365a472862c123b65601e0f2c93862c6
EBUILD pygobject-2.16.1-r1.ebuild 2191 RMD160 69e472fb5e6fed2a29e3ef0adcd288791298b415 SHA1 3119f2852aa3ff9220af26560076809ae69f0e3d SHA256 1236fd892a156d5c549ca5171aa8fc57447596319fc168d14c0a1c7a2dcf5d60
EBUILD pygobject-2.16.1.ebuild 2284 RMD160 035b3fe2fa009485734c8618d701c195f8c5c594 SHA1 bbe684b63e42890a71c3b61d7faba17a61187864 SHA256 c44843fe43db7350c23d4f2d9112be8f91967939b73fca5482be5cc76a78814e
EBUILD pygobject-2.18.0-r2.ebuild 3542 RMD160 b9550c94def359a0fd352b1c61053f550269fcda SHA1 aa93408ac4eb26c6ed136fd1fc8001b209330aa8 SHA256 f7a726ff632c1b8de6a505bc871feca528d75919c175496246a09beee7f3ecb9
EBUILD pygobject-2.18.0.ebuild 2467 RMD160 566299b75231dd6e6c51f9a2aa3d0283ec9c99fa SHA1 5d823b29adc50e95585628f558c28c34c62b5708 SHA256 8cff760264dee195549a672b0b0591181d0dbbc7b5f16060fc619d7d1e92d0ed
-MISC ChangeLog 11432 RMD160 b95ee61ee9d95b2eca06f890b29772eea8ea69be SHA1 9c4812aed4688897017999d6a8652b648ad73c9d SHA256 d3109114cc2703d4b17cce60c1f0567729a228269ea45751e6493498b14d68b2
+MISC ChangeLog 11637 RMD160 f2922d3eb98ce37d6f2f480e9e1c9c6ec6a201a6 SHA1 11658ce9f4d0e4d067100004579f0d54edb080b3 SHA256 022114a24913b2a4c88a977b502bbe97c6472a8df7eb06c750683e94e41758f7
MISC metadata.xml 282 RMD160 32fd779b50e24af15b5d30862d362cef786e2930 SHA1 6603342ce4d848c26dd1a585eeebc1b84198f2fa SHA256 116a6827697ff69c8f1971077502e9fa2b0d2fd23e57c97d4b54b3d1495597ca
diff --git a/dev-python/pygobject/pygobject-2.14.2.ebuild b/dev-python/pygobject/pygobject-2.14.2.ebuild
index de53ff13914a..2da5a39e919c 100644
--- a/dev-python/pygobject/pygobject-2.14.2.ebuild
+++ b/dev-python/pygobject/pygobject-2.14.2.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2009 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/pygobject/pygobject-2.14.2.ebuild,v 1.13 2009/08/16 22:49:57 arfrever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pygobject/pygobject-2.14.2.ebuild,v 1.14 2009/10/14 09:56:39 ssuominen Exp $
inherit alternatives gnome2 python autotools virtualx
@@ -10,7 +10,7 @@ HOMEPAGE="http://www.pygtk.org/"
LICENSE="LGPL-2"
SLOT="2"
KEYWORDS="alpha amd64 ~arm hppa ia64 ~mips ppc ppc64 ~s390 ~sh sparc x86 ~x86-fbsd"
-IUSE="doc examples libffi"
+IUSE="doc examples"
RESTRICT="test"
# glib higher dep than in configure.in comes from a runtime version check and ensures that
@@ -26,11 +26,7 @@ DEPEND="${RDEPEND}
DOCS="AUTHORS ChangeLog NEWS README"
pkg_setup() {
- if use libffi && ! built_with_use sys-devel/gcc libffi; then
- eerror "libffi support not found in sys-devel/gcc." && die
- fi
-
- G2CONF="${G2CONF} $(use_enable doc docs) $(use_with libffi)"
+ G2CONF="${G2CONF} $(use_enable doc docs) --without-libffi"
}
src_unpack() {
diff --git a/dev-python/pygobject/pygobject-2.15.4.ebuild b/dev-python/pygobject/pygobject-2.15.4.ebuild
index e5ad940aa435..c21773027bbf 100644
--- a/dev-python/pygobject/pygobject-2.15.4.ebuild
+++ b/dev-python/pygobject/pygobject-2.15.4.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2009 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/pygobject/pygobject-2.15.4.ebuild,v 1.3 2009/08/16 22:49:57 arfrever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pygobject/pygobject-2.15.4.ebuild,v 1.4 2009/10/14 09:56:39 ssuominen Exp $
inherit alternatives autotools gnome2 python virtualx
@@ -10,7 +10,7 @@ HOMEPAGE="http://www.pygtk.org/"
LICENSE="LGPL-2"
SLOT="2"
K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86 ~x86-fbsd"
-IUSE="doc examples libffi"
+IUSE="doc examples"
RDEPEND=">=dev-lang/python-2.4.4-r5
>=dev-libs/glib-2.16
@@ -22,11 +22,7 @@ DEPEND="${RDEPEND}
DOCS="AUTHORS ChangeLog NEWS README"
pkg_setup() {
- if use libffi && ! built_with_use sys-devel/gcc libffi; then
- eerror "libffi support not found in sys-devel/gcc." && die
- fi
-
- G2CONF="${G2CONF} $(use_enable doc docs) $(use_with libffi)"
+ G2CONF="${G2CONF} $(use_enable doc docs) --without-libffi"
}
src_unpack() {